Shielding Card Holder System
A shielding card holder system for providing a versatile protector and holder which shields wireless transmissions from a card such as a smartcard. The shielding card holder system generally includes a card protector adapted to shield wireless transmissions from a card such as a smartcard. A card holder is removably attached to the card protector, the card holder being adapted to removably receive cards of varying thicknesses. A protector magnet on the card protector is adapted to magnetically engage with a holder magnet on the card holder or the card holder itself to removably attach the card holder to the card protector. A securing member may be utilized to secure the card protector against an article of clothing, with the securing member including a securing magnet adapted to magnetically engage with the protector magnet through the clothing.
PACKAGING STORAGE CONTAINER
The present application relates to a packaging storage container, including a container bottom portion, a container cover portion, a ridge member and a tray. The container bottom portion is provided with a pair of articulated shaft-receiving bases, the tray is connected to a pair of articulated shaft-receiving bases through an articulated shaft, an inner space for self-adaptive rotation and shock absorption of the articulated shaft is formed in the articulated shaft-receiving base. The articulated shaft-receiving bases comprises a connecting piece and a pair of limiting walls, and the connecting piece is provided between the pair of limiting walls and is an arc-shaped piece curved upwards, the articulated shaft is provided with a pair of protruding portions with column shape in axial direction thereof, a longitudinal length of the articulated shaft between the pair of protruding portions is configured to correspond to the articulated shaft-receiving base.
HINGED SUPPORT APPARATUS WITH POSITION STOPS
A hinged support apparatus that can include a mounting plate, an elongated base, and two living hinges on the elongated base. The mounting plate can have a proximal and a distal end. The elongated base can have a proximal end, a midway point, and a distal end, wherein the proximal end of the elongated base can be attached to at least a portion of the proximal end of the mounting plate and the midway point can create a proximal half and a distal half of the elongated base. A first of the two living hinges can be located between the proximal end and the midway point of the elongated base. A second of the two living hinges can be located between the first living hinge and the midway point of the elongated base. The two living hinges can be parallel to each other and can pivot in the same direction.

Wallet
A wallet (10) comprises at least a wall (12) substantially rectangular and suitable to be bent at least along a main bending axis (P1), to define at least two main flaps (13a, 13b) positioned on opposite sides with respect thereto. At least a main containing element (26a, 26b) is attached on at least one surface (15a, 15b) of each of said main flaps (13a, 13b), so that each containing element (26a, 26b) defines at least a first pocket (27) having sizes such as to contain at least a standard-sized rectangular card (28). When the wallet is closed and the main flaps (13a, 13b) are bent one over the other along the main bending axis (P1), a main containing element (26a, 26b) attached on a determinate main flap (13a, 13b) is adjacent to, coplanar and therefore not overlapping, another main containing element (26b, 26a) attached on another main flap (13b, 13a).
FLEXIBLE SCANNER RESISTANT DEVICE EMULATING A BANKNOTE FOR PROTECTION OF RFID CARDS
A device for protecting one or more credit or charge cards from radio frequency scanning is disclosed. The device comprises a rectangular-shaped planar element sized for fitting within the banknote slot of a personal carrying accessory, wherein the planar element is composed of a top layer of plastic material having an interior surface including printed information, a middle layer of a metallic foil that inhibits the transmission of radio frequency signals, and a bottom layer of plastic material having an interior surface including printed information, wherein the top layer and the bottom layer of plastic material completely cover a surface area of both sides of the middle layer, and wherein the device has a thickness of about 0.3 mm and exhibits a bending stiffness substantially equal to paper.
Satchel And Wallet Combination Assembly
A satchel and wallet combination assembly includes a container that is flexible and includes a perimeter wall having an upper end open to access an interior of the container. The container may be manipulated into a folded condition wherein the container is folded multiple times upon itself and into a deployed condition wherein the container is unfolded. A wallet is attached to a front wall of the container such that a top edge of the wallet is positioned adjacent to the upper end and the first lateral edge of the container. The wallet is positionable in the container when the container is in the deployed condition. The container is abuttable against the wallet when the container is in the folded condition such that the container has a length and width substantially equal to a length and width of the wallet.
Compression card holder
Disclosed is a card and money holder for simultaneously holding paper money and wallet sized cards, such as those containing credit or identification information. Said card and money holder comprises a generally rectangular prism shaped card and money holder, and a compression plate inside the rectangular shaped card and money holder. The card and money holder may hold one or a plurality of cards with said cards being held securely in place. The design allows for a unique rotation method of inserting cards into the card and money holder while card removal can be achieved one handed by sliding a card through the retrieval slot.
Payment Card with Removable Insert and Identification Elements
Aspects described herein may allow for a payment card assembly including a payment card having a first surface, an opposed second surface, and an aperture extending through the payment card from the first surface to the second surface. An insert may be removably received in the aperture. Each of a plurality of identification elements may be configured to be removably received in the aperture and have an identification characteristic different than an identification characteristic of each of the other identification elements.
